Match Commentary

  • 15': Bruno Felipe (Pafos)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 20': Dani García (Olympiakos)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 25': Second yellow card to Bruno Felipe (Pafos) for a bad foul.
  • 33': Substitution, Pafos. Mislav Orsic replaces Landry Dimata.
  • 34': Substitution, Pafos. Kostas Pileas replaces David Luiz because of an injury.
  • 36': Lorenzo Pirola (Olympiakos)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 45'+5': First Half ends, Olympiakos 0, Pafos 0.
  • 45': Substitution, Olympiakos. Mehdi Taremi replaces Gabriel Strefezza.
  • 45': Substitution, Olympiakos. Christos Mouzakitis replaces Dani García.
  • 45': Second Half begins Olympiakos 0, Pafos 0.
  • 61': Substitution, Olympiakos. Costinha replaces Rodinei.
  • 72': Mehdi Taremi (Olympiakos)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 75': Substitution, Olympiakos. Stavros Pnevmonidis replaces Santiago Hezze.
  • 76': Substitution, Olympiakos. Giulian Biancone replaces Lorenzo Pirola.
  • 77': Substitution, Pafos. Bruno Langa replaces João Correia.
  • 77': Substitution, Pafos. Ken Sema replaces Jajá.
  • 86': Substitution, Pafos. Anderson Silva replaces Vlad Dragomir.
  • 88': Bruno Langa (Pafos)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 90'+7': Second Half ends, Olympiakos 0, Pafos 0.
